Okay so I haven't played in a long time, but I remember that I used to use this card wrong. So pretend you and I are playing. Pretend it is my turn. I am about to use my pestilence. Since I don't have to tap it, Can I pay more than one black mana for the damage? How does that work?

@littlelorelai: Yes, you can pay more than one to use Pestilence's ability. You can do it as many times as you have mana. Technically, each time you tap and use it is a separate event on the stack and should be done one by one, but I don't know anybody who really worries about it if you just say you're tapping for 5 damage or whatever. If they have something they want to do in response to the first activation, they can just say so and you can wait to activate the remaining 4 or whatever amount you are planning to use. Also, your post mentions it is your turn when you do this. Although you can use Pestilence on your turn, I generally prefer to wait until my opponent's turn, just to discourage him from playing any creatures or attacking me.

Shroud only protects creatures from spells or abilities that have 'target' in their wording. Since this says 'each creature' and not 'any number of target creatures' shroud does nothing.

You can keep Pestilence in play for a long time with the help of Reassembling Skeleton . Save a few mana and just bring the Reassembling Skeleton back onto the battlefield before the end of turn and Pestilence stays in play.
